Perfect driver for:
Golfers of all skill levels, but especially those who want more distance and forgiveness.

The TaylorMade Stealth 2 Driver builds on the original Stealth, enhancing distance with its new 60X Carbon Twist Face for faster ball speeds and improved forgiveness on off-center hits. It features a Carbon Reinforced Composite Ring and a higher Moment of Inertia (MOI) for straighter shots. This driver prioritizes distance while maintaining ball speed and accuracy for better green performance, and it offers various loft and shaft flex options.

The TaylorMade Stealth 2 Driver has a big 460cc clubhead that's super forgiving on off-center hits. Plus, the draw bias helps fight off those pesky slices. The carbon face lives up to the hype too, I get some serious distance out of this thing. The head is on the larger side, so it might take a swing or two to get used to it, but once you do, the forgiveness and distance are worth the adjustment.

Perfect driver for:
Mid-to-high handicappers who want a forgiving driver that helps them bomb the ball further.

Designed for maximum forgiveness, the Ping G425 Max Driver boasts the highest Moment of Inertia ever in a Ping driver. This translates to straighter, longer shots on off-center hits, ideal for golfers seeking more distance and accuracy off the tee. The G425 driver features a lightweight, aerodynamic design for increased clubhead speed and a 26-gram tungsten movable weight for personalized shot shaping.

The Ping G425 Max Driver is all about blasting bombs down the fairway, even on mishits. It's got a forged titanium face designed to increase ball speeds on off-center hits. I love the clean, aerodynamic look at address. Ping incorporated their Dragonfly Technology in the design to make the club lighter and faster swinging, which can help generate more clubhead speed for more yards. They come in a few different loft options, so you can find the right fit for your launch preferences. Overall, if you're a golfer who prioritizes forgiveness and wants to add some serious yardage to your drives, the Ping G425 Max Driver is a top performer.

Perfect driver for:
Mid-to-high handicappers who want a forgiving driver that helps them bomb the ball further.

The Ping G430 Max Driver delivers next-level forgiveness for golfers seeking more distance off the tee. Featuring a refined design with one of the highest MOI ever in a Ping driver, it offers maximum forgiveness on off-center hits for straighter, longer shots. The shallower, thinner VFT forged face with Spinsistency technology aims to generate explosive ball speeds across the face, while a lower centre of gravity promotes a higher launch for longer carry distances.

The Ping G430 Max Driver is a bomber with some serious forgiveness. It's got a large clubhead with a draw bias to help straighten out slices, and a forged titanium face designed to increase ball speeds on off-center hits. I love the clean look and the feel at address, and it even sounds better than previous Ping drivers.

Perfect driver for:
Golfers looking to maximize their distance and forgiveness.

The TaylorMade Sim2 Max Driver takes the groundbreaking Shape In Motion design to the next level with a reengineered Inertia Generator crafted from a 9-layer carbon sole. This lightweight, aerodynamic component is precisely angled to boost clubhead speed during the most crucial part of the golfers swing. Engineered for both speed and forgiveness, the SIM2 Max features a hefty 24g tungsten weight positioned low and back for high MOI and added stability. A strategically placed TPS Front Weight on the sole promotes a mid-to-high launch with controlled mid-to-low spin, delivering powerful, consistent performance off the tee.

Perfect driver for:
Golfers looking to add more distance and accuracy to their drives.

The TaylorMade Qi10 Driver offers golfers distance and forgiveness with its lightweight 60X Carbon Twist Face, enhancing ball speeds and performance on off-center strikes. Its lower center of gravity and higher Moment of Inertia improve forgiveness, while the adjustable loft sleeve allows for trajectory adjustments.

The TaylorMade Qi10 Driver boasts a massive bump in forgiveness compared to its predecessor. It has a clean look behind the ball, feels solid, and well-balanced at address. Some golfers might find the lack of an adjustable hosel a turn-off, and it isn't the cheapest driver on the market. But for the vast majority of golfers who prioritize forgiveness and distance in a driver, the TaylorMade Qi10 Driver is a strong option.

Perfect driver for:
Golfers with high swing speeds or skilled golfers seeking lower spin over forgiveness and high launch.

The Titleist TSR3 driver has an enhanced sweet spot, improved aerodynamics, and refined SureFit CG Track and Hosel to provide exceptional ball speed, launch conditions, and adjustability options. The TSR3 also has a cleaner sole, which rescues drag on the downswing for faster club speed.

Perfect driver for:
Golfers seeking more distance off the tee without sacrificing forgiveness on mishits.

Callaway's Mavrik Driver offers forgiveness and adjustability for powerful tee shots. Its large clubface features a Flash Face designed with Artificial Intelligence to boost ball speed, even on off-center hits. Jailbreak Technology enhances speed and forgiveness, making the Mavrik ideal for golfers seeking distance without sacrificing accuracy and allowing for customizable launch conditions.

The Callaway Mavrik Driver is a strong contender for golfers looking for a well-rounded package of distance, forgiveness, and feel. It's not the newest Callaway, but you cant beat its performance for the price. The A.I. designed face optimizes ball speeds across a larger area of the face, which means even mishits can travel far. I love the feel and sound of the Mavrik at address and impact. This might not be the driver for you if your are looking for more adjustability options, but it’s a forgiving driver that delivers distance without sacrificing feel.

Perfect driver for:
Players who create consistent contact and require more precise control over CG placement.

The Titleist TSi3 Driver caters to golfers who value a compact shape and adjustable weighting. Its Speed Chassis design enhances energy transfer, and the SureFit CG track offers five custom positions for ball flight optimization. Ideal for low-handicap players seeking distance or mid-handicap golfers wanting control, the TSi3 can boost performance.

The Titleist TSi3 Driver is a game-changer for golfers seeking workability and distance in a premium package. This driver isn't for everyone, though. It's designed for better players who prioritize control over pure forgiveness. It packs a punch with a large, 460cc clubhead, but it feels smaller and sleeker at address than some drivers thanks to its classic shape. The focus here is on precision and shot-shaping, and I love the responsive feel at impact. Some golfers might find the TSi3 a bit less forgiving on mishits compared to some max forgiveness drivers, but I think the distance and workability gains are worth the trade-off.

Perfect driver for:
Golfers that are looking to deliver exceptional distance and high launch.

The TaylorMade Stealth Driver features a 60x Carbon Twist Face for fast ball speeds and enhanced forgiveness. Its polyurethane-covered face uses nanotexture technology for better launch and spin. With low and back weight for high MOI, it offers stability and accuracy. Additional features like an asymmetric inertia generator and Thru-Slot Speed Pocket make it ideal for golfers seeking speed and distance.

The TaylorMade Stealth Driver represents a significant leap forward in technology. Its carbon fiber face delivers ball speed consistency, making it a favorite among tour professionals and serious amateurs alike. The sleek, all-black design appeals to those who appreciate understated style. If you like a sleek, stealthy design and want a driver that’s as powerful as it looks, this is it.
